Transaction 32bf3dcbfac346b9c3ebf8ba2bd941e3301463708ad098c7c843f725e4e24d51

block
76eb452f3080cc215ab220bd8486288b2c817a5c7813568520c65b78a113d958

20 Inputs

1 Output